Output 6ca542497a21b8462e51bdd8d71cea14ca584a0633039150c387b54e672c0744:7

value
3316400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28896c9e0df6e958af8dafbc29965c40dc467604 OP_EQUAL
address
MBbVtWYhoEJkkZLqsA9UarvMyzA3igCW8d
transaction
6ca542497a21b8462e51bdd8d71cea14ca584a0633039150c387b54e672c0744
spent
true